    Did anyone else choose to file their I-130 online and I-485 mailed in? My partner and I filed I-130 and I-130A in June of this year and sent in a copy of the application as a supplement for the I-485. However, we've gotten rejected twice now for both I-130 and I-485 based on "incorrect fees" (both times we submitted $1,225 - the first all in one check, and the second time with the I-485 filing fee and biometrics fee broken out; the I-130 was paid for online and we've attached and highlighted the receipt notice).

    Additionally, they noted in the most recent notice that the I-130 form wasn't current. Given the I-130 was filed online, we had no choice over which version of the from to use and filled out the application as was provided. We now see on the top right corner of the form that it expired on Feb 28, 2021, despite us getting and filing the form online in June. Is the best fix here to withdraw our original I-130 and file completely new forms (the I-485 form we used expired at the end of September too)?
